At first, I found this moisture meter quite handy and easy to use. However, it didn’t take long for me to realize it has significant flaws. This meter doesn’t just detect water; it also picks up metal and other non-water materials, which creates a lot of confusion.When I tested it around my house, a few areas gave red readings, which initially alarmed me. I was sure there wasn’t any water in those spots, but I almost called someone for a full inspection, worried about potential water damage. Thankfully, I looked into it further and discovered the issue was caused by a metal frame on the other side of the wall, not water.To confirm my suspicion, I experimented further. When I tested my thin table surface, the meter showed it as dry. But when I placed a piece of metal or my phone underneath, it gave a red reading, indicating moisture. This inconsistency made it impossible to trust the device, so I decided to return it.If you’re looking for a reliable moisture meter, I’d recommend exploring other options. This one caused more confusion than it solved, and I wouldn’t rely on it for accurate results.
